Subject: Key rotation ahead of Thursday's sync

Hey all — quick heads up for the weekly sync: we're rotating the Plumefall fan-out key as part of the backpressure fixes. The new shed-load thresholds mean stale keys get dropped hard, no retries. Swap yours before Thursday or notifications will silently queue. Old key dies at noon. The new key for the fan-out service is below.

gateway credential: kto23_LX9A4ys6i4nzHtpOLNLodKK

TICKET FV-2281: PodLint validator staging env misconfigured. The feed-fetch worker on Quarrelbay staging was pointed at the production signing endpoint, so validation runs signed prod manifests for three days. Rotation done; prod key revoked. Remaining gap: the staging env file still lacks the replacement fetch credential, causing silent fallback to anonymous mode and skipped auth checks. Review scope of exposed manifests before closing. To restore authenticated fetches, add the following line to staging's env file:

env line for fafof-fahag: LEDGER_TOKEN5=f8790

**Waveform preview blank in SoundLattice plugins.** If the preview pane renders empty, verify your plugin calls `renderPeaks()` after the decode callback, not before. Stale cache entries also cause blank previews; clear `~/.soundlattice/peakcache` and reload. If peaks still fail, the preview service is rejecting unauthenticated requests. Retry your fetch with the bearer token below attached to the Authorization header.

bearer token for hahif-tafog: eyJhbGciOiJIUzI1NiIsInR5cCI6IkpXVCJ9.eyJzdWIiOiIK-h47iIewNIn0.fxe2zI4PI_zk

Handover: GraphLattice visualizer (from Mirel to Odran). The renderer caches resolved dependency trees under /var/lattice/cache; purge it before any schema migration or stale edges will persist. Layout workers run on the Tessfold cluster and restart nightly. If the admin console locks you out after three failed attempts, you will need the recovery passphrase stored in the team vault. For convenience, it is reproduced here.

strongbox words: istwyn-normir-silwyn-ulaius-istwyn